Summary
This bulletin contains repair instructions for twisted seat belts.
69 Front seat belt twisted

Condition
Customer states:
One or both front seat belts are twisted.
Workshop findings:
The seat belt webbing was pulled through the deflector of the seat belt height adjuster while twisted. The
twisting of the seat belt webbing is predominantly caused by the "seat belt park function" featured in the
reversible seat belt tensioners.
Technical Background
When exiting the vehicle, the seat belt can slightly twist when unbuckled. This twist can move up to the deflector
of the seat belt height adjuster when the seat belt retracts. If the “seat belt park function” then occurs, this twist
can be pulled past the seat belt deflector resulting in a completely twisted seat belt.
Production Solution
The implementation of modified seat belt deflector guides for A6, A7, A8, and Audi
e-tron quattro during
production is in the planning stages.
The modified seat belts were implemented in Q8 production starting in December of 2019.

Service
A6, A7, A8, and Audi
e-tron quattro
1.
Remove the upper B-Pillar trim on the affected side according to the repair manual.
2.
Remove the bolt of the seat belt deflector
(Figure 1, Pos. 3).
Tip: It is not necessary to remove
the seat belt to perform this repair.
Figure 1. Seat belt deflector at height adjuster with B-Pillar trim
removed.
3.
Use your thumb to remove the old belt
guide (plastic part) from the steel
deflector. Start by detaching the guide
from the bolt hole, then press out the
lower section covering the metal tab
(Figure 3).
Note:
Do not use sharp objects to remove the
old belt guide to avoid damaging the seat
belt webbing.

Figure 2. Backside of seat belt deflector. Deflector trim tabs
engaged in old belt guide.
Figure 3. Removing old seat belt guide starting at the bolt hole.
4.
With the old belt guide removed, turn the
seat belt webbing to remove the twist
(Figure 4).
Figure 4. Old seat belt guide removed. Seat belt twist corrected.
5.
Install the modified belt guide 4K8 857 799 on the front driver side and 4K8 857 800 on the front passenger
side (Figure 2, Pos. 4).

6.
Start installing the modified seat belt
guide at the deflector metal tab (Figure
5).
Figure 5. Installing modified seat belt guide starting with the
metal tab on the bottom.
7.
Push the new guide into the bolt hole
until you can hear the plastic retainers
snap into place (Figure 6).
Figure 6. Seat belt deflector with new guide installed.

8.
Inspect the front of the deflector for
proper installation of the guide locking
tabs at the bolt hole (Figure 7, Pos. 6)
Figure 7. Belt guide locking tabs correctly secured at bolt hole.
9.
Inspect the back of the deflector for
proper installation of the deflector trim
locking tabs to seat belt guide (Figure 8,
Pos. 7)
Figure 8. Seat belt deflector trim locking tabs properly secured
to seat belt guide.
10. Reinstall the seat belt deflector at the height adjuster according to the repair manual.
11. Completely pull out the seat belt to ensure that the belt retracts as designed.
12. Reinstall the B-Pillar trim according to the repair manual.

Tip: Only perform this repair on the affected side.
Q8
1.
Replace the affected front seat belt according to the repair manual.
2.
Order the modified seat belt according to the parts table (refer to ETKA for color code).
Tip: Only perform this repair on the affected side. Only order modified seat belts for twist concerns.
For all other concerns, the non-modified seat belts can be used.
